From: High-dose IL-37 promotes inflammatory activity of macrophage via Preferential ligation of the IL-18Rα

Fig. 3

High-dose rIL-37 could not reverse T2DM induced by HFD and STZ. (A) rIL-37 at 100 ng/ml concentration decreased the fasting blood glucose level of experimental T2D effectively, but 1000 ng/ml rIL-37 did not. (B, C) rIL-37 at 100 ng/ml concentration improved glucose tolerance (IPGTT) and insulin tolerance (ITT) effectively in experimental T2D, but 1000 ng/ml rIL-37 did not. (D) The 100 ng/ml rIL-37 effectively reduced immunohistochemical staining of F4/80-positive cells in islets of experimental T2DM but 1000 ng/ml rIL-37 can not. (Scale bar = 50 μm). (E) Enhanced level of serum IL-37 in patients with T2DM compared with healthy controls. HC, healthy control; T2DM, type 2 diabetes mellitus. vs. WT-normal group, *P<0.05, **P<0.01, ***P<0.001; vs. WT-T2DM, &P<0.05; vs. IL-37 100 ng/ml, #P<0.05, ##P<0.01.
